Holders on track

Dubai: The world's top-ranked pairing and defending champions Cara Black and Liezel Huber eased past the Chinese duo of Shuai Peng and Tiantian Sun 6-3, 6-3 to enter the doubles quarterfinals.
Black and Huber, winners here last year with a 7-6 (6), 6-4 win against Svetlana Kuznetsova and Alicia Molik, were in total control as they started their title defence in style.
They will now meet the pairing of Sania Mirza and Francesca Schiavone in the quarterfinals after the Indo-Italian duo beat wild card entrants Kuznetsova and Amelie Mauresmo in straight sets 6-4, 6-4.
Fourth seeds Yung-Jan Chan and Chia-Jung Chuang of Chinese Taipei and the unseeded duo of Vladimira Uhlirova and Galina Voskoboeva secured contrasting wins to also advance to the last eight.
Chan and Chuang won 6-3, 6-3 against Tatiana Poutchek and Anastasia Rodionova, while Uhlirova and Voskoboeva fought their way to a tight 6-3, 3-6, 11-9 win over wildcards Stephanie Foretz and Selima Sfar.
Second seeds Katerina Srebotnik and Ai Sugiyama had already booked their place in the quarters at the lower end of the draw with a 6-2, 4-6, 10-6 win over Anabel Medina Garrigues and Virginia Ruano Pascual on the first day.
